High demand for Peugeot 308 prompts French carmaker to hire additional workers

Fresh from being crowned the 2014 European Car of the Year at the recently concluded Geneva Motor Show, the second-generation Peugeot 308 is quickly becoming one of the French carmaker's most popular models.

The new 308 has had 60,000 orders placed since its launch in October. Due to the high demand and the addition of the newly launched 308 SW (station wagon) model, PSA Peugeot Citroen will increase output at their Sochaux plant in France by adding a night shift starting this June.

PSA will hire 600 workers, which will include 450 on temporary contracts. The additional night shift will boost the daily output of the car to 1,563 units.

The second-generation 308 rides on PSA's new EMP2 modular platform, which allows it to have compact dimensions and lower weight compared to the previous-generation model. It competes with other cars in the C-segment like the Ford Focus, the Volkswagen Golf and the Opel/ Vauxhall Astra. It's offered in two body styles: hatchback and station wagon.
